When I hear the words autumn in New York my mind goes to beautiful autumn views of Central Park. We get those views -- for about a week or two -- but mostly the signs of autumn aren't much different than autumn anywhere else. One day this week I was walking in my neighborhood, the Upper West Side, and started taking pictures of things that caught my eye. At first it was just a few random pictures, but I realized that in the five blocks I walked between the post office and my Pilates class I'd captured an autumn afternoon in the neighborhood.   


My favorite local pizza place was decorated for Halloween

 
This looks so yummy

After passing the pizza store I came to Magnolia Bakery, which you may remember, was featured in Sex and the City. Their specialty is banana pudding, but this autumn variation looks as just as good. I managed to walk past the store, but it was a temptation. There are two/three/four food stores on many blocks. There are new bakeries, ice cream stores and restaurants in just about every direction. There is literally temptation at every turn, but usually I can resist. At some time, though, I just  may succumb to this apple treat.   
 

The mums brightened up the landscape and definitely were worth a picture


One of my favorite stores, a local stationery store

I made sure to walk by the local stationery store on West 72nd Street. I love stationery stores -- fun pens, stickers and all kinds of treats -- and fortunately there are still two independent stores in the neighborhood. When I need a stationery item I (almost) always stop by one of them. The local stores are what make the neighborhood interesting and I try to patronize them when I can. I knew this store would be decorated for the fall/Halloween and I wasn't disappointed.
